Activity objectives
Youth participation and young people’s active engagement in society are key priorities of the European Youth Programmes. Sport organisations and clubs can play an important role in supporting young people to take part in society and community life. For many young sporters, their sport clubs are like a second home where they develop their personalities and have their social relations.
The Erasmus+ Youth Programme offers sports clubs low-threshold opportunities to develop their own projects that empower young people through sport and strengthen their civic and social competences.
This special edition of the training course “Dive into Youth Participation” is the first edition specifically designed for the sport sector. It brings together 25 representatives of sport organisations such as coaches, sports instructors and leaders from across Europe. The course aims to strengthen their understanding of youth engagement and youth participation and to explore how it can be integrated into sports activities and club life. Participants will also learn more about the funding opportunities within Erasmus+Youth, especially Key Action 154 – Youth Participation Activities.
The activity will take place in Vierumäki, Finland, between 14-17 September 2026 (arrival 14 September, departure 17 September)
